Manager, Software Engineering- Fintech
The Manager, Software Engineering role at Jobber involves leading the Invoicing and Jobber Payments Engineering teams to enhance financial services for small businesses. The position requires a strong full-stack technical background, leadership experience, and a commitment to team development and collaboration with stakeholders.
Staff Software Developer
Auvik is seeking a Staff Software Developer to lead technical excellence and solve complex problems. The role involves designing, coding, debugging, and shipping high-quality software using languages like Go, Scala, and TypeScript. The ideal candidate will have a strong grasp of system design, clean coding practices, and debugging complex issues, and will collaborate with cross-functional teams to build impactful features.
Software Engineer
Courier Health is seeking a Software Engineer to design, build, and scale software systems supporting patient engagement for chronic and rare diseases. This generalist role involves both backend and frontend contributions, utilizing technologies like AI/LLMs to innovate product features. Key responsibilities include owning projects end-to-end in collaboration with cross-functional teams and participating in maintaining production systems via on-call rotations.
Engineering Manager, Core Product Engine
The Engineering Manager, Core Product Engine, will be responsible for evolving the core insurance automation systems from a legacy, tightly coupled design into a robust, fault-tolerant framework. This involves spending significant time leading incremental refactoring efforts to establish new standards for predictability and testability. Over time, the role shifts towards implementing an AI-first approach to build the next generation of internal tools capable of scaling the user base significantly.
Engineering Manager
The Engineering Manager will lead the evolution of critical insurance automation systems into a robust, fault-tolerant framework capable of scaling across new transaction categories. This hands-on role requires leading incremental refactoring of legacy, tightly coupled logic while ensuring the new architecture is predictable and testable. Eventually, the manager will shift focus to adopting an AI-first approach for building the next generation of internal tools to support massive user growth.
Get Jobs Like These
Weekly TypeScript jobs delivered to your inbox.
Tech Lead Manager, Automation
The Tech Lead Manager for Automation will report directly to the co-founder/CTO, focusing on evolving critical automation systems for an insurance marketplace. Initial phases involve deep technical work leading incremental refactoring of legacy, tightly coupled systems into a scalable architecture. The role will eventually shift towards an AI-first approach to build the next generation of internal tools to support growth from 5M to 50M users.
Senior Software Engineer
The company seeks a Senior Software Engineer skilled in building high-performance, responsive web applications using composable, headless architectures, specifically leveraging Next.js and React. Responsibilities include developing modern, interactive websites, providing technical guidance, and collaborating across product, design, and engineering teams. This role involves both greenfield builds and supporting live production environments through incident triage and enhancements. The ideal candidate has over five years of development experience, deep expertise in modern frontend technologies, and knowledge of accessibility standards.
Senior Software Engineer - Digital Agency
The Senior Software Engineer will join a digital agency team to design and build complex, scalable front-end features for multiple client projects, ensuring performance and maintainability. Key responsibilities include independent development, code review, contributing to architecture, and collaborating cross-functionally. The role requires deep expertise in modern web technologies, offering 100% remote work with high competitive USD compensation.
Senior Software Engineer - Digital Agency
The Senior Software Engineer will join a digital agency team to design, develop, and maintain complex front-end features across multiple client projects, ensuring scalability and performance. Key responsibilities include writing high-quality code, participating in architectural decisions, and collaborating closely with design, product, and back-end engineering teams. This fully remote role requires expertise in modern web technologies like React and TypeScript to deliver polished user experiences for high-impact projects with U.S. companies.
Senior Software Engineer, Manufacturing (travel Required)
The Senior Software Engineer will join the rapidly scaling technology organization, focusing on developing features and improvements for Dandy applied Supply Chain stack, which manages custom manufacturing planning, routing, and delivery. Key responsibilities include developing order routing logic, partnering on CAD to CAM automation, and building systems to optimize workloads and provide real-time order status data. This role requires 6+ years of full stack experience, substantial knowledge of backend asynchronous systems, and involves heavy travel (50%) to the Indianapolis office.
Get Jobs Like These
Weekly TypeScript jobs delivered to your inbox.
Engineering Manager, Automation
The Engineering Manager role focuses on evolving critical automation systems used for orchestrating complex, multi-step insurance policy transactions. Responsibilities include deep hands-on technical work leading the refactoring of legacy systems into a decoupled, scalable architecture. As the architecture stabilizes, the role will pivot toward using an AI-first approach to build the next generation of internal tools for massive user growth.
Full-Stack Software Engineer - Remote (canada / Latam)
This role is for a Full Stack Software Engineer at a YC-backed AI SaaS platform focusing on creator marketing infrastructure. Key responsibilities include owning product features end-to-end, leading engineering architecture, mentoring others in AI-native workflows, and shipping scalable backend systems (Python/GCP) and responsive UIs (React/TypeScript). The ideal candidate must have 2-6 years of experience and deep proficiency in using AI coding tools like Claude Code as their primary development environment.
Senior/staff Software Engineer
Homebound is seeking Senior or Staff Software Engineers to modernize homebuilding by developing a full-stack platform supporting internal operations and customer-facing tools. Responsibilities include designing, building, and delivering high-quality, production-grade code across the platform lifecycle, while contributing to architectural decisions. Candidates must have significant professional software engineering experience, a track record of shipping impactful products, and actively utilize AI coding tools in their daily workflow.
Senior Software Engineer I, Production Management
Dandy is seeking Senior Software Engineers to develop and enhance their next-generation Supply Chain stack, which manages the manufacturing backbone of their custom product business. Key responsibilities include developing custom planning and scheduling systems, supporting domestic and international logistics, and building rules-based software capabilities to optimize real-time operations. The role requires 6+ years of full-stack experience, strong ability to operate independently, and skill in communicating complex technical solutions to stakeholders.
Engineering Manager
This Engineering Manager role focuses on evolving critical, complex insurance policy automation systems from a brittle, speed-focused architecture into a robust, scalable, fault-tolerant framework. The manager will spend 80% of their time hands-on, leading incremental refactoring, designing new standards, and mentoring engineers, before shifting toward an AI-first approach for future scaling. The position requires a builder mentality, deep expertise in asynchronous system design, and a passion for debugging complex business logic to handle transactions involving external parties.
Get Jobs Like These
Weekly TypeScript jobs delivered to your inbox.
Staff Software Engineer - Us (remote)
Luxury Presence is seeking a Staff Software Engineer to serve as a technical leader driving high-impact initiatives for their AI growth platform in real estate. Key responsibilities include leading the design and implementation of complex systems, defining architectural standards, and mentoring engineers across teams. The role requires deep expertise in JavaScript/TypeScript, Node.js, React, and experience operating scalable microservices on AWS.
Staff Software Engineer - Canada (remote)
The Staff Software Engineer will serve as a technical leader driving high-impact initiatives related to systems, architecture, and the AI-first platform strategy for an AI growth platform in real estate. Key responsibilities include leading the design and implementation of complex systems, defining architectural standards, and mentoring engineers across teams. This role requires deep expertise in JavaScript/TypeScript, Node.js, and React, alongside experience operating scalable microservice architectures on AWS.
Staff Software Engineer, Core Platform
The Staff Software Engineer on the Core Platform team will drive the technical strategy for critical infrastructure and security systems to enable the entire engineering organization to ship products quickly and securely, especially as the company expands to support enterprise customers. Responsibilities include leading complex, multi-quarter initiatives, designing internal platforms, improving reliability, and building enterprise-ready capabilities like FedRAMP-aligned infrastructure. The role requires deep expertise in system design, distributed systems, and cloud infrastructure (AWS), coupled with strong leadership skills to mentor senior engineers and influence technical direction across teams.
Senior Software Engineer I, Clinical Experience (mexico)
The Senior Software Engineer I will join the Clinical Experience team at Dandy to help build new features and products that modernize the dental industry through technology. This role involves owning problems end-to-end, focusing on user experience, data models, scalability, and ongoing metrics using Typescript, React, GraphQL, Node, and PostgreSQL. Candidates must have 5+ years of experience and possess strong self-direction, high standards, and excellent communication skills.
Software Engineer (distributed Systems)
The Software Engineer (Distributed Systems) will be responsible for the core Execution layer of Inngest, focusing on orchestrating step functions and events to ensure durable and reliable code execution. Key duties include architecting solutions, implementing performance improvements for high request volumes, and designing user-facing APIs using languages like Golang and TypeScript. This role requires significant experience with distributed systems and directly impacts millions of developers using the platform.